Goss Propane Torch Kits with Pencil or Brush Tips

Goss Propane Torch Kits are complete professional-grade torch systems designed for soldering, brazing, heating, and general repair applications using propane fuel. Each kit combines the comfortable AP-1 screw-in torch handle with an EP-70G regulator, HEF-10 hose, MP-1 lighter, and a BP-Series flame tip.

Two configurations are available to match different heating requirements. The KP-102 includes a BP-2 pencil flame tip for concentrated heat and precision work, while the KP-105 includes a BP-5 brush flame tip for broader heat coverage.

Pencil vs. Brush Flame

BP-2 Pencil Flame

The BP-2 pencil flame tip concentrates heat into a smaller area, making the KP-102 well suited for controlled soldering, localized heating, and other applications requiring a more focused flame.

BP-5 Brush Flame

The BP-5 brush flame tip spreads heat across a wider area, making the KP-105 useful for broader soldering, heating, bending, and general maintenance applications.

AP-1 Screw-In Torch Handle

Forward Valve Control

The AP-1 features a forward-mounted adjustment valve that allows convenient one-handed flame control while operating the torch.

Interchangeable Tips

The screw-in connection accepts compatible Goss BP-Series tips, allowing the flame style to be changed without replacing the complete torch handle.
